Left 4 Dead 2 maxed out - Source Engine on highest quality

What is the maximal visual quality offered by Left 4 Dead 2, the latest game based on Valves' Source Engine? Screenshot specialist Jay.Gee shows what can be squeezed out of the aged structure.
Left 4 Dead 2: Maximum graphics (19)
 
Left 4 Dead 2: Maximum graphics (19) [Source: view picture gallery]
Left 4 Dead 2 has been released, only one year after the first part. Nevertheless the game seems to be popular among journalists and fans. At Metacritics, a review collection site, it reached 90 percent on average and the user ratings are quite good, too - Nine out of ten possible points. After the game has now finally been published, there now are the first screenshots that make the aged engine shine again. In our preview gallery you can find several pictures from screenshots artist Jay.Gee who proved several times to have a talent for impressive images. The original shots were taken at 1680 x 1050 with 8x MSAA and 16:1 AF.
